About OCCRP
With staff across six continents and hubs in Washington, D.C., Amsterdam, and Sarajevo, OCCRP is one of the largest investigative journalism organizations in the world — and we’re growing. We are a nonprofit, mission-driven newsroom that partners with other media outlets to publish stories that spur action, so that the public can hold power to account.
Position Overview
We are looking for a social media video specialist who is excited about turning our hard-hitting investigations into engaging video formats across multiple platforms. In this newly developed role, you’ll partner with members of the editorial, audience engagement, journalism products and other teams to lead and execute video content creation for social media and fundraising.
You are creative, organized and driven, and you know how to translate complex information into high-quality content that resonates with viewers. You are able to connect with the core audiences of platforms like Instagram and YouTube and can teach us a thing or two. Since you will be responsible for the entire process of video production (ranging from ideation through distribution), having strong collaboration and communication skills is essential.
With your charismatic personality and deep belief in the power of investigative journalism to make the world a better place, you will be able to bring OCCRP’s unique investigations to new platforms and help us engage with new audiences.
What your day-to-day will look like:
- Creating content for social media plat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and YouTube. This includes being on camera, filming, and editing.
- Managing video projects from conception through completion. This includes pre-production planning, production coordination, and post-production editing.
- Staying updated with and keeping the rest of the team informed on new trends, technologies, and audience insights
- Creating and maintaining our library of video content, finding opportunities to resurface and create evergreen content
- Evaluating video performance and growth opportunities and communicating these findings to relevant stakeholders
- Covering live events, including capturing and editing content for rapid turnaround.
